Mentoring & Inspiring Women in Radio Biography
Lindsay B. Cerajewski
Lindsay’s achievements in the world of radio sales started almost immediately when she acquired her first account executive position and won “rookie of the year” for the Indianapolis Emmis radio cluster (a 5 station cluster.) Since then, Lindsay became an integral leader and revenue developer for each of her stations winning awards along the way such as “Best Idea Sold,” “All American Employee of the Year,” & “Chairman’s Club.” In 2008, Lindsay was honored with 1 of 15 national scholarships to the inaugural “Rising Through the Ranks” management workshop from the Radio Advertising Bureau, BMI and the MIW group. Lindsay was also awarded 1 of 3 mentorships through the MIW’s Mildred Carter Mentorship Program for the calendar year of 2009. Lindsay Cerajewski currently sits on the Board of Directors for the Media Ad Club of Chicago, and is the Seminar Chairperson within that board. She also is currently serving a 2 year term for Scarborough’s Radio Advisory Board, representing the Central Region. Lindsay was honored to be asked by the MIW’s to sit on the MIW Executive Committee representing the Mildred Carter Mentees (a newly created post on the MIW Executive Committee.) Lindsay received her B.A. in Telecommunications and Business from Indiana University-Bloomington. She is a graduate of the Dale Carnegie Sales Institute and is a Certified Solutions-Based Master Facilitator through Creative Resources. She lives in the Old Town Neighborhood in Chicago. |
